Are You Ready for College?

Not everyone who goes to college is completely prepared for the experience. You could be a mature student, there could be gaps in your education, or you could be undecided about which program is best for you.

Taking a general or preparatory program gives you post-secondary experience and a track record. It also fills in academic gaps and prepares you for more specific training.

Success in one of our preparatory or general certificate or diploma programs could also dramatically increase your chances of getting into high-demand college or university programs.
